Diference between R/3 ECCS & SEM BCS

<b>Hi all,
We ve to compare the two systems R/3-ECCS and SEM-BCS in detail as we are goin for consolidation using SAP. Could you people suggest something regardin this.
It will be very nice if you could suggest some parameters based on which these to be compared.</b>

The main difference is that you don't have to pay additional licence fees for R/3 EC-CS, because it is part of R/3. As long as you didn't buy mySAP ERP or the mySAP Business Suite you would have to buy an additional SEM license to use SEM BCS.
As far as I know, R/3 EC-CS offers all necessary functionality for consolidation and is a sophisticated product.
But in the end, SEM BCS will be the path to the future, even if the implementation might be not so easy today.

    Feddin,
    in EC-CS you have only one consolidation unit object. So if you are dealing with a matrix org then you have to compound for example company code and profit center into a CS unit object. This potenially creates a lot of units and therefore maintenance overhead.
    With BCS you can keep the two dimensions separated and all combinations are valid (without the need to create them).

    There is nothing like better or worse product.
    BCS has some strong features like consolidation monitor, investment consolidation and for most consolidation functions, configuration is very easy. In BPC, you may have to write scripts.
    BCS has BW as the backbone  where for BPC 5.1 there is none. Howveer, in  BPC 7.0, the BPC will rest on BI and things will be much better.

  • Remote Extractor and Real Time Infocube for SEM BCS

    Hi Experts,
    I have somes doubts about the integration between SEM and BW.
    There is a cycle that have the next processes:
    1.- begin in R/3 with the movements in FI, CO and/or general ledgers
    2.- Activate the extractors standards for replicate/extract data to BW. For example, 0FI_GL_XXXX.
    3.- Configure a method for take the information from BW to SEM.
    4.- My doubt begin here... For take the information from SEM to the real time infocube, where I configure?  What Have I for configure?
    The real time infocube, What is the proposal? Where take the data?  Here, Do the remote extractor begin to apply?
    Thank you very much for your collaboration.
    Regards,
    Jeysi Ascanio

    We're using 0FI_GL_20 to read directly from FAGLFLEXT into SEM-BCS via a BI remote cube.  There are some basic transformations in BI to "populate" the remote cube, then a standard Load from Data Stream in BCS to do final mappings.  In the BCS workbench, just create a source data basis off the remote cube.
    This works at my current project due to fairly low ECC data volumes.  If you are doing any complex mapping on the Company or Fiscal Year / Period infoobjects, you may need to create a inverse mapping routine in the remote cube to transfer selection criteria.  If you see messages in the monitor following a data load such as "xx,xxx of xxx,xxx records ignored", that means that you are reading too much data from ECC and it is only getting filtered on the BCS side.  We had this problem with a custom extractor and adding an inverse mapping routine cut the load from ~5min to 30sec.  (Basically, the custom, template-delivered, extractor only had 0FISCPER, not 0FISCPER3 and 0FISCYEAR, so we would read all 17 K4 periods into BI, map them into BCS, then BCS would throw out the unneeded periods.  Unfortunately, we did not have the option to change the extractor, so this was the best approach.).
    If I had large data volumes, I would use a regular BI basic cube for staging (or possibly a multi-cube with a mix of basic and realtime, depending on the load requirements to BCS).
    If you use 0FI_GL_20, I would strongly recommend you implement OSS Note 1245822, or be on SAP_APPL 603.0002 or later.

  • SEM-BCS Statistical FS Items (Statistical: Balance and Statistical: Flow)

    Hi,
    SEM-BCS 4.0 and SEM-BCS 6.0 both have 2 types of Statistical FS Item (Financial Statement item); "Statistical: Balance" and "Statistical: Flow".
    I note that these are treated differently, e.g. in Balance Carryforward task, Statistical: Balance are carried forward automatically while Statistical: Flow are not.
    My question is, what is the difference between these statistical item types?
    And what are they (or could they be) used for?

    Hi,
    I'll try to explain you like the following:
    Balance is a value that is derived from beginning balance plus movement. Flow is the movement itself.
    Trial balance is an example of balance, while movement type is an example of flow.
    When you do balance carry forward, system add all the flow type that you define to make a balance, and carry forward the balance only.
